Metacomet - Belchertown
Went out Wed. Morning to R&R Sports in Belchertown to pick up shiners. They were out. I talked with 3 different area bait shops and all have run out of shiners at one time or another this year. So, if you're planning a trip you may want to get your bait the night before if you have an aerator to keep them alive. Finally got some bait and arrived at Metacomet. One guy had just released a bass he said was about 4 1/2 pounds. Another had caught a salmon, about 6 pounds. Two of us set up 8 tip-ups and used two jigging rods. We ended up with 6 nice crappie, one yellow perch and one white perch. I had never seen a white perch in that pond before. Most fish were caught on jigs. Although we did have about 8 flags during the day most just ran a little bit and dropped the bait. Everything except the yellow perch was taken home and filleted.
